What Are Lab Grown Diamonds?
Lab grown diamonds, also known as synthetic or cultured diamonds, are created in controlled laboratory environments using advanced technological processes. These processes replicate the high-pressure, high-temperature conditions under which natural diamonds form beneath the Earth’s crust. There are two primary methods used to produce lab diamonds: High Pressure High Temperature (HPHT) and Chemical Vapor Deposition (CVD). The result is a diamond that is chemically, physically, and optically identical to its mined counterpart.
How Lab Grown Diamonds Differ from Natural Diamonds
While lab grown and natural diamonds share the same carbon structure and crystal formation, their origin sets them apart. Natural diamonds take billions of years to form and are extracted through mining, a process that often raises ethical and environmental concerns. Lab grown diamonds, on the other hand, can be produced in a matter of weeks without the destructive environmental impact associated with mining. This makes them a more sustainable and responsible option.
From a visual perspective, even expert gemologists need specialized equipment to distinguish between the two. Lab grown diamonds are graded using the same criteria as natural diamonds, known as the 4Cs: Cut, Clarity, Color, and Carat weight.
Advantages of Lab Grown Diamonds
One of the most significant advantages of lab grown diamonds is their affordability. On average, they cost 30% to 40% less than natural diamonds of comparable quality. This cost-effectiveness allows buyers to purchase larger or higher-quality stones within their budget.
Another major benefit is ethical sourcing. Traditional diamond mining has long been associated with labor exploitation, conflict financing, and ecological harm. By choosing lab grown diamonds, consumers can avoid supporting these practices and feel confident about the origins of their jewelry.
Sustainability is also a driving factor. Producing diamonds in labs uses fewer natural resources and generates a smaller carbon footprint compared to mining operations. As environmental awareness continues to influence purchasing decisions, this aspect of lab grown diamonds makes them especially attractive to eco-conscious consumers.
Applications Beyond Jewelry
While lab grown diamonds are most commonly associated with engagement rings and fine jewelry, their applications extend beyond fashion. These diamonds are used in various industrial sectors due to their exceptional hardness and thermal conductivity. In electronics, they are used in semiconductors and high-performance heat sinks. In the medical field, they play a role in precision cutting instruments. The versatility of lab grown diamonds adds to their overall value and relevance across industries.
Changing Perceptions and Market Growth
Initially, lab grown diamonds faced skepticism, with some consumers viewing them as inferior alternatives. However, advancements in technology and increased awareness have shifted public perception. Today, many top jewelers and luxury brands include lab grown diamonds in their collections, signaling mainstream acceptance.
The global lab grown diamond market is growing rapidly. As technology improves and production costs decrease, more companies are entering the industry. This competition is driving innovation and making high-quality diamonds more accessible than ever before. Analysts predict continued growth in the coming years, especially as younger generations prioritize sustainability and ethical sourcing in their purchasing decisions.
